This modern detached family home measuring over 2000sq feet is ideally situated within easy reach of the village and local schools, offering both convenience and a sense of community. The property features ample parking to the front, including space for multiple vehicles and an electric vehicle (EV) charger, with access to an integrated garage.
Upon entering the spacious entrance hall, one finds access to a shower room and a versatile study, which could also serve as a fourth bedroom. The hallway leads into a modern, well-equipped kitchen/breakfast room, complete with Corian worktops and a useful utility room. The utility room provides additional storage and access to the garage. The kitchen seamlessly flows into the dining room, which in turn leads into the living room, creating an exceptional open-plan living space. The living room boasts wood flooring, a wood burner, and sliding doors that open to the rear garden and substantial terrace, enhancing indoor-outdoor living.
A feature staircase ascends to the first-floor landing. The main bedroom suite is a standout feature of the home, offering a dressing room, an en-suite bathroom with both a bath and a shower, and a private balcony overlooking the rear garden. Two further double bedrooms provide ample space, and a well-appointed family bathroom serves these rooms.
Additionally, the property includes a self-contained annexe on the ground floor, comprising a bedroom, living area, and shower room. The annexe has its own front door from the garden, as well as internal access from the dining area, offering flexibility for multi-generational living or potential rental income.
This home combines modern design with functional living spaces, making it an ideal choice for families seeking comfort and versatility.
Outside
The landscaped westerly aspect rear garden is mostly laid to lawn with mature herbaceous boarders, a full width patio allows for amazing outside entertaining and alfresco dining and a particular feature in our opinion are the solar panels. To the front there is off-street parking and access to the garage.
Situation
Fetcham Village offers a range of eateries including both Italian and Indian restaurants, there is the advantage of a Sainsburys Loca, Boots Chemist, GreenWise an organic food shop with cafe and William Dyer Deli, as well as local bistro pub The Bell. There is a good selection of both private & state schools, for example Manor House, St Teresa's, Danes Hill, Park Side, Eastwick infants & Junior, Fetcham Village Infants, Oakfield Junior school as well as The Howard of Effingham & Therfield Secondary Schools. Nearby Leatherhead offers a train station with direct trains into London as well as more extensive shopping, a cinema theatre, an array restaurants, bars and cafes. Leatherhead Leisure Centre offers a good variety of facilities. While for the outdoor enthusiast there are a number of local stables, golf courses, local commons and river walks as well as being near to Norbury Park, Polesden Lacey and it is even possible to hike to the local vineyard Denbies.
